Discussed topics
Facilities with cooling application - 9
Electron cooling -22
Stochastic cooling - 9
Muon and (ionisation) frictional cooling - 4
Cooling and storage in traps - 2
Medical applications - 1
Laser cooling - 1
Among of them
New projects of facilities under development:
NICA, FAIR, ELENA at CERN, Cryogenic Storage Ring at MPI,
LEPTA at JINR, EI Collider at Jlab, eRHIC at BNL
Novel ideas under development: coherent electron cooling,
frictional cooling

Facilities and experiments with cooling application
around the World:
US
Tevatron (Fermilab), RHIC (BNL)
EU
AD: ALPHA, ATRAP, ASACUSA (CERN),
COSY (FZJ), ESR & SIS-18 (GSI), TSR (MPI)
Japan S-LSR (Kyoto Univ.)
China CSRmand CSRe (IMP CAS)
Russia LEPTA (JINR)
